Output 8a21cb3781c745b1ffe69af83eb335638ad038c5f6e4176832c090ea372000f5:40

value
8538000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a21aa47ac504bddeb2e09f3987e54ee2aa8513 OP_EQUAL
address
3FhMW5inwdVSYLvRepgJJ8tcibJX3aqoQp
transaction
8a21cb3781c745b1ffe69af83eb335638ad038c5f6e4176832c090ea372000f5
spent
true